## Runbook: DocSentry linter recovery

If DocSentry begins rejecting plugin-supplied rule bundles with schema errors, first confirm your plugin targets the v3 manifest format; older bundles are silently downgraded and then fail validation on the next pass. Clear the rule cache on the Hollowmere staging node before retrying, as stale compiled rules will mask a successful fix. Do not disable the linter globally. Once the cache is cleared, restart the linter daemon with the following configuration values.

service settings:
[casax]
port = 6379
team = rusir
host = casax.zemvarhq.corp
region = outer-4
access_code = ac_9808ce
timeout_ms = 1500

## Further reading

Dedupe in Corvid Desk is automatic for exact email matches; fuzzy matches queue for review. Support should never merge records manually — use the merge tool so order history and ticket threads follow the surviving record. Unmerges are possible within 30 days, after that it's a data request. Common edge cases: shared family emails, rebranded business accounts, typo domains. The full dedupe policy and the merge tool walkthrough are documented on the internal page below.

wiki page, tahaf-tajog: https://jira.ordindyn.corp/pipeline

Subject: Budget ask — quick heads-up

Hi all, looping in our incoming director, Petra Vandstrom, so she's not blindsided next week. The Corrigan Bay team has put in a budget request covering two new field reps and a refresh of the Moonvale demo kit. It's a bit chunky, but the pipeline numbers back it up. I'd like us aligned before the finance sync on Thursday. Full reasoning is in the confidential note below.

confidential, kagep-kahof: Druokax Systems plans to lower the Ulaath list price by 53 percent in March.

## Build Provenance: Stormcaller Fan-Out

The Stormcaller service fans weather alerts out to regional relays operated by Cloudmere Labs. Because alert payloads are safety-relevant, every deployed artifact must be traceable to a reviewed commit: the pipeline signs each build, records the reviewer roster, and embeds the provenance manifest in the container. Reviewers should verify the manifest matches the merge record before approving promotion to the Hallowmere region. The current production artifact carries the provenance token below.

build token for fajof-yahof: htk4_869f